Example #1
0
double
ProfileInstance::getTotalTimeMicroseconds()
{
  if (mRunning)
  {
    stopTimer();
    startTimer();
  }
  double result;
  PROF_CONVERT_TO_MICROS(mElapsedTime, result);
  return result;
}
Example #2
0
double 
ProfileInstance::getTotalTimeMicroseconds()
{
	UINT64 totalTime = mElapsedTime;
	if (mRunning) {
		UINT64 currentTime;
		PROF_GET_TIME(currentTime);
		totalTime += currentTime - mStartTime;
	}
	double result;
	PROF_CONVERT_TO_MICROS(totalTime,result);
	return result;
}